Historic Mantua with modern comfort
I don't see how anyone could fail to fall in love with the Appartamento affrescato (previously called Contrada San Domenico), and it's among the most attractive places where I've stayed in Italy, or anywhere else for that matter.
DECORATION AND FURNISHING. The Appartamento is a self-contained flat on the first-floor of a seventeenth-century house in Mantua, and it makes a spectacular impression on the visitor because of its (largely) eighteenth-century frescoed ceilings and walls. These were uncovered by the owners, Luigi Piatti and Francesca Barbera (hope I've got the surnames right), during a meticulous conservation programme that was completed last year. At the same time, modern comforts like underfloor heating, an elegant modern kitchen, and two bathrooms with showers were installed in the height of good design and functionality.
The owners have furnished the flat very elegantly. They also provide far more of the things one might need during a stay than I was expecting, having clearly paid a great deal of attention to detail. This includes piles of interesting books to read, and plenty of information on the city and how to find one's way round it, which was thoughtful. The WiFi connection is completely reliable and easy to set up.
LAYOUT AND QUIETNESS. The flat is spacious with a large sitting room overlooking Via Mazzini and two bedrooms. The one to the rear is particularly substantial, with an arch between an ample seating area with a television and the larger section with a big and comfortable bed. This room is particularly quiet because it's on the more secluded side to the property. The big casement windows throughout the flat are double-glazed so sound insulation is excellent. But it would be quiet anyhow and the flat has a tranquil and relaxing character.
SHOPPING. As regards food shopping, there are plenty of places to go, but it's handy that there's a supermarket not far away, the Carrefour in Piazza 80o Fanteria (easiest to find via Corso della Libertà) that's open twenty-four hours and has a big stock. Francesca told me it's more expensive than other local shops, but it makes up for this in convenience. Of the restaurants in central Mantua, I was bowled over by LaCucina in Via Guglielmo Oberdan and went back there several times.
LOCATION. The Appartamento is in the middle of the city. It doesn't take more than about 15 minutes to walk there from the station. It would be less to walk from the flat to Palazzo Te, or, in the other direction, to Palazzo Ducale. So, if you want to visit the great historical sites in Mantua – or anywhere else in the city – it's in an ideal location. I found it easy to return mid-day to make myself a snack or cup of coffee – part of the convenience of having what's really a home in which to stay rather than a hotel room.
MANAGEMENT. I found the flat through Booking.com and the process was very user-friendly. During my visit Isotta, one of the conservators who had worked on restoring the frescoes, kept an eye on the property and she showed me how everything worked in the flat. Luigi and Francesca, the owners, were attentive and very efficient. I got an immediate response to phone calls or emails, and things ran smoothly. They all speak perfect English, which is very helpful (if also a little shaming). They may ask for a cash deposit to cover possible damage to the frescoed walls – which seems reasonable enough – but I got the feeling it's more an issue if a large group stays, or perhaps a family with children. The request is entirely reasonable, given that the Appartamento is a very special property and I suspect has heavy costs for restoration and maintenance. Overall, I felt very welcome by Luigi, Francesca and Isotta while remaining independent, which was a good mix.
Staying in the Appartamento added a great deal to my visit to Mantua, and rather than just being a place to sleep it became a part of my experience of the city and its history in its own right. In fact, it was tempting just to sit and relax in my elegant surroundings. Perfect.
